A/H1N1 Virus

• Index Case – Mexico in March 2009

• By end of 2009 – PANDEMIC

• Virus – “2009 H1N1 Virus”

• SWINE FLU / HUMAN FLU

– REASSORTMENT

• Glycoproteins –

– Heamagglutinin – Binds to receptors

– Neuraminidase – Helps initiate the infection

Spread

• Swine Flu doesn’t often infect people, and in past have mainly affected people who had contact with pigs.

• Current ‘swine flu’ outbreak is different. It can spread from person to person among people who have not had any contact with pigs.

Person to Person??

• This virus can survive for hours on surfaces.

– Upto 48hrs on hard non porous surfaces like stainless steel.

– 12 hrs on cloth and tissues.

• Few min on your hand. So??

contd

• Spread primarily through respiratory droplets.

1. Coughing

2. Sneezing

3. Touching with contaminated hands.

Risk?

• Pregnant women – six times more likely than non pregnant women.

• Young children – under 2 yrs.

• Lung diseases – COPD.

• Asthma.

• Immune Suppression – HIV, Ca therapy.

• Liver, kidney, neurologic problems.

Treatment

• Tamiflu or Relenza

• These antiviral drugs are most effective when

taken within 48 hours of the start of flu

symptoms.

• It's resistant to older flu drugs.

Not everyone needs treatment with these anti-

flu drugs. Most people who come down with

H1N1 swine flu recover fully -- without

antiviral treatment

• H1N1 Does not spread by eating pork.

Vaccine

Clinical tests show the 2009 H1N1 vaccine worksremarkably well.

• People ages 10 and older need only one dose ofthe vaccine. Protection begins about eight daysafter vaccination.

• Kids under age 10 will need two vaccinations,given three weeks apart.

• The vaccine is highly effective -- and, accordingto early results from clinical trials, very safe -- inpregnant women
